How Relationship Decision Making Works

Relationship decision making is complex because it involves multiple factors: emotional connection, compatibility, timing, personal readiness, and practical considerations. When these factors conflict, it can create decision paralysis. This love decision wheel helps you break through that paralysis by forcing a choice and revealing your emotional response.

The psychology behind using a relationship decision maker is that your reaction to the random result often reveals your true preferences. If you feel relieved by "Yes," that suggests you were leaning toward that option. If you feel disappointed by "No," that might indicate you actually wanted "Yes" all along. This emotional clarity is one of the most valuable aspects of using a decision maker tool for relationship choices.
